Output 04aa50023e8542f90980a6a352feb40a783e99123d775b015d42bc8b1e5e33c8:0

value
17039658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cb7b4897de61a86d8eece3f3fad881843b38542 OP_EQUAL
address
3FyfQXomLDgGFh7uRy1cEipPisQztjBbb9
transaction
04aa50023e8542f90980a6a352feb40a783e99123d775b015d42bc8b1e5e33c8
spent
true